Achieving Agility and Resilience: Leveraging the Composable Cloud Infrastructure Strategy Approach

Estimated Reading Time: 5 minutes
July 25, 2023
Achieving Agility and Resilience: Leveraging the Composable Cloud Infrastructure Strategy Approach

In our current economy, marketers and analysts are looking for solutions to innovate and adapt quickly to the changing business and consumer needs. Every business is undergoing and is at some stage of their digital transformation to better connect their product and services with their customers. Brands across all industries are accelerating their efforts to access data efficiently to create reports, analyze marketing trends, forecast consumer behavior, and foster collaboration across organizations. The focus is primarily on building a resilient infrastructure to help sustain long-term revenue growth.

This is where a composable cloud infrastructure strategy approach can help. It can enable teams to adopt an agile methodology by providing the resources they need when they need them, while also helping them save costs and optimize their analysis workloads. This approach enables organizations to build, deploy, and manage their applications and services more efficiently, flexibly, and cost-effectively.

Understanding Composable Cloud Infrastructure

For analytics, composable cloud infrastructure is the designing of cloud computing architecture to support advanced data analytics and business intelligence workloads. This enables users to dynamically compose or configure computing resources, such as compute, storage, networking and data modeling to meet the specific needs of their analytics applications. What it means to your organization is that the composable infrastructure provides a high degree of flexibility and agility to rapidly provision and scale the infrastructure to meet changing business requirements. For marketers and analytics teams in your organization, this is the ability to accelerate data analytics initiatives, gain deeper insights into their data, and drive business outcomes with higher ROI.

One of the leading Cloud solutions that can provide composable cloud infrastructure to organizations is Google Cloud Platform (GCP). GCP offerings provide composable infrastructure for marketing and analytics through its various services and tools, which can be integrated to create customized marketing and analytics solutions. Here are some of the key features and components of Google’s composable cloud offering:

Modular architecture: A composable cloud strategy involves breaking down cloud infrastructure into smaller, more manageable components. This enables IT teams to easily add or remove components as needed to meet changing business needs. Google Cloud offers a wide range of modular services that can be easily integrated with each other or with third-party services to build custom cloud solutions. For example, Google Cloud offers modular services for compute, storage, networking, and machine learning.

Data storage and processing: Google Cloud offers a range of data storage and processing services, such as Cloud Storage, Bigtable, and BigQuery, which can be used to store and process large amounts of data generated by marketing and analytics activities. According to Gartner’s Peer Insight Review, BigQuery specifically is one of the top rated data warehouses for marketers that uses Google Marketing Platform (Google Analytics 4, Google Ads, DV360, etc.) because it integrates with a variety of tools and platforms, including data analytics and visualization tools, making it an ideal platform for operationalizing advanced analytics. This enables organizations to easily collect, store, and analyze data from multiple sources, such as social media, website traffic, customer interactions, and more. Also, organizations can choose the storage option that best suits their needs and scale it up or down as necessary.

Automation and APIs: A composable cloud strategy relies on automation tools and processes to enable IT teams to quickly and easily provision and configure cloud resources. Google Cloud offers a range of automation tools and services, such as Cloud Deployment Manager, Cloud Functions, and Cloud Run to enable IT teams to quickly and easily provision and configure cloud resources. Additionally, APIs are a critical component of a composable cloud strategy, that enables IT teams to easily integrate and manage cloud resources. This can help enable greater flexibility and faster innovation. Google Cloud offers a robust set of APIs that enable IT teams to easily integrate and manage cloud resources. Google Cloud APIs are well-documented and easily accessible, making it easy for developers to build custom cloud solutions.

Machine learning and AI: Google Cloud also offers various machine learning and artificial intelligence services, such as Cloud AI Platform, AutoML, and TensorFlow, which can be used to analyze data and gain insights into customer behavior and preferences. These services enable organizations to gain insights from their data and build intelligent applications from which it can help create personalized marketing campaigns, optimize pricing strategies, and improve customer engagement.

Data Visualization and reporting: Google Cloud also offers various tools and services for data visualization and reporting, such as Looker Studio and Looker, which can be used to create interactive dashboards and reports for marketing and analytics teams. These tools can help organizations track their performance, identify areas for improvement, and make data-driven decisions.

Overall, Google Cloud Platform provides composable infrastructure for marketing and analytics that is modular, standardized, automated, API-driven, and secure. GCP’s ease of integrating these services and tools provides organizations with a more agile, efficient, secure, and scalable cloud infrastructure to create customized marketing and analytics solutions that meet their specific needs and goals.

Still confused about Google Cloud Platform?

Our team of experts is here to help whenever you need us.

Author

Last Updated: July 25, 2023

Get Your Assessment

Thank you! We will be in touch with your results soon.
{{ field.placeholder }}
{{ option.name }}

Talk To Us

Talk To Us

Receive Book Updates

Fill out this form to receive email announcements about Crawl, Walk, Run: Advancing Analytics Maturity with Google Marketing Platform. This includes pre-sale dates, official publishing dates, and more.

Search InfoTrust

Leave Us A Review

Leave a review and let us know how we’re doing. Only actual clients, please.

  • This field is for validation purposes and should be left unchanged.